为什么大家都喜欢“人天”作为估算单位?
发布于 2024-01-18
3493
版权声明
我们非常重视原创文章,为尊重知识产权并避免潜在的版权问题,我们在此提供文章的摘要供您初步了解。如果您想要查阅更为详尽的内容,访问作者的公众号页面获取完整文章。
Bruce Talk
扫码关注公众号
扫码阅读
手机扫码阅读
在工作中常参与投标项目的工作量评估和迭代用户故事的评估,发现“人天”作为评估单位易于被接受。本文探讨了人天估算的起源、定义、优缺点以及在制造业与软件开发中的应用差异。
人天估算的起源
人天评估起源于20世纪初,最早在美国30年代的制造业使用,后被引入计算机软件开发。随时间发展,人天评估成为项目管理中的常用技术。
什么是人天估算
人天估算使用人天(一人工作一天的时间)来衡量完成项目的时间,以便控制项目进度。这种方法简单,非技术人员也容易理解,适用于需要严格时间管理的项目。
人天估算的缺点
人天估算准确性依赖于详细的需求文档和设计,且在新技术或未知领域的项目中可能导致估算不准。因此需要考虑项目的不确定性和风险。
一些思考
人天估算源自制造业,适用于知识固化且操作标准化的环境。然而在软件开发中,由于知识和技能的主体性,以及完成相同工作的个体差异,人天估算的不确定因素更多。尽管人天估算整合了时间、工作量和成本的信息,但它假设每个人的能力和产出相同,这在软件项目中并不现实。
相对于人天估算,敏捷估算使用相对估算,通过参考团队过往类似任务的实际数据来更准确地估算任务规模、复杂度。敏捷估算在认可度上可能存在挑战,但能使工作更有意义。
Bruce Talk
Bruce Talk
扫码关注公众号
还在用多套工具管项目?
一个平台搞定产品、项目、质量与效能,告别整合之苦,实现全流程闭环。
查看方案
Bruce Talk的其他文章
重新理解“软件工程”
说了也听了这么多年“软件工程”,我们真的知道“软件工程”要解决的东西吗?
验收测试驱动开发后记
ATDD能给我们带来哪些切实的变化?哪些额外的收获?来说说我们团队的真实体会。
打破Scrum的五个误区(译)
Scrum是当今敏捷圈种最流行的一个方法,但是今天让我们了解一下Top 5的对Scrum误解。
一次用户故事拆分分享
分享实际场景中的一次用户故事拆分。
程序员如何利用AI加持
着chatGPT这类平民化的AI工具的普及,新的AI工具越来越多的融合到人们的日常工作中,对于工具的要求自然会提高,对可用性的容忍度也是越来越低。而作为开发这类软件的程序猿来说,应该及时的做出调整,看如何能够更精准、更好的提供服务。
加入社区微信群
与行业大咖零距离交流学习
PMO实践白皮书
白皮书上线
白皮书上线